Meaning of Rachida

Rachida originates from the Arabic language, specifically from the triliteral root ر-ش-د (r-sh-d), which encompasses meanings related to guidance, maturity, and correctness. As the feminine form of Rashid, it translates to ‘rightly guided’ or ‘one who follows the right path.’ In Islamic context, this name is highly valued as it reflects divine guidance and moral integrity, often mentioned in religious texts and prayers. The name is well-documented in classical Arabic dictionaries and etymological studies, confirming its meaning across various Muslim cultures. Its usage spans regions influenced by Arabic, including North Africa, the Middle East, and South Asia, where it retains its original significance.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Rachida has its roots in pre-Islamic and early Islamic Arabic culture, where names derived from the root r-sh-d were common to denote wisdom and proper conduct. It gained prominence in Muslim societies as a name embodying spiritual virtues, often given to express hopes for a child’s righteous life. Over centuries, it spread through trade, migration, and Islamic expansion to regions like Persia, South Asia, and Africa, adapting slightly in pronunciation but retaining its core meaning. Today, it remains popular in countries such as Algeria, Morocco, Egypt, and among diaspora communities, reflecting enduring cultural and religious traditions.

Famous People Named Rachida

  • Rachida Dati — French politician and former Minister of Justice
  • Rachida Brakni — French actress and director of Algerian descent
